Fiberglass

Pultrusion is a technique used to create fiberglass windows and doors. Through this automated process lengths of fiberglass roving and strand mat are soaked in resin, then covered by a protective veil, then pulled through heated dies to form long rods and strips known as "lineals." The lineals are then snared together using hidden nylon-reinforced corner blocks to form tight, strong joints. The doors and windows are finished with an exterior and interior coating to ensure durability, beauty and weather resistance.

These windows are a great option for homeowners looking to lighten up the look of their home with an energy-efficient upgrade. They're available in a wide variety of finishes and colors and are easy to maintain. They're also resistant to mold, rot and swelling. The composite material used in the production of the doors and windows has high strength and low moisture absorption. It also resists temperature changes.

Double-pane windows are made up of two identical panes of tempered glass insulated that are sealed as one unit. These windows are popular with homeowners who want to reduce energy costs, insulate from noise, extreme temperatures and other environmental influences. The space between the glass is filled with either argon or krypton gas which creates an air barrier that prevents heat transfer. The frame's material and design along with the glass type, can influence the windows' energy use and the labeling.

There are several ways to replace double glazing windows-pane windows. You can choose to replace the entire sash frame, or you can simply replace the IGU (insulated glass unit) panel within the sash frame. The latter option can be less expensive, however it may not provide the same level of energy efficiency as a brand new window.
